#!/usr/bin/env node /** * benchmark-intelligence.mjs — Real, reusable benchmark harness for the * RuVector / AgentDB intelligence stack. * * Measures, on the machine it runs on, against the BUILT exports under * v3/@claude-flow/cli/dist/src/... * (never against source, never hardcoded): * * 1. HNSW search vs in-process brute-force cosine baseline * at N = 1000, 5000, 20000, 50000: * - per-query ms (HNSW + brute force) * - speedup ratio (brute / hnsw) * - recall@10 (HNSW results vs exact top-10) * 2. Int8 quantization: measured compression ratio + reconstruction cosine. * 3. RaBitQ: memory compression ratio (+ retrieval speed if a populated * index is feasible, else null with a reason). * 4. SONA WASM adapt latency (ms/call, warmed). * 5. MoE gate: confirm the gate LEARNS (probability/Q shift after rewards). * 6. Embedding backend actually in use (onnx vs mock) — honest. * * DESIGN NOTES * ------------ * - All vectors are generated with a seeded deterministic RNG so the run is * reproducible and safe to re-run. We deliberately do NOT route HNSW/quant * benchmarks through the embedding backend: that backend can be mock on a * given machine, which would make the structural benchmarks non-deterministic * and conflate two separate measurements. The embedding backend is instead * reported HONESTLY as its own item (#6). * - Every number printed/emitted comes from a measurement in THIS process. * Unmeasurable items are emitted as `null` with a `reason` string. * - Exit code is 0 on success (a benchmark being unmeasurable is not a failure; * only an unexpected crash is). The script prints a markdown table to stdout * and writes a machine-readable JSON object after a `===BENCH_JSON===` marker. * * USAGE * node scripts/benchmark-intelligence.mjs # default sizes * node scripts/benchmark-intelligence.mjs --sizes 1000,5000 * node scripts/benchmark-intelligence.mjs --queries 50 --dims 384 * node scripts/benchmark-intelligence.mjs --json-only * * Created for the ruflo intelligence stack.
